Dr. Prajwal Oswal

Casualty Medical Officer at KEM Hospital Pune

Dr. Prajwal Oswal currently serves as a Casualty Medical Officer at KEM Hospital Pune, where responsibilities include managing life-threatening emergencies, performing critical procedures, and coordinating with consultants for patient management. Prior experience includes a role as a Medical Officer in Phase II clinical trials of CAR-T cell therapy at Tata Memorial Centre and an internship at Bharati Hospital Pune, where Dr. Oswal managed a diverse range of medical cases during the COVID-19 pandemic. Education includes an MBBS from Bharati Vidyapeeth, along with experience in mentoring and teaching students in various capacities, including volunteering to support underprivileged medical aspirants. Additional roles within organizations like IFMSA highlight Dr. Oswal's commitment to medical student representation and administration.

KEM Hospital Pune

KEM Hospital, Pune is a Multispeciality Tertiary Care Teaching Hospital. Serving the healthcare needs of people in Pune district of Maharashtra State in India since 1912, the KEM Hospital Pune, has grown to be one of the larger private hospitals in the region. KEM Hospital is run by the KEM Hospital Society,and is a registered public charitable trust hospital. KEM Hospital Pune is a tertiary level teaching hospital that serves not only the population of the city of Pune but also caters to patients from surrounding regions referred to us for quality yet affordable healthcare services. In keeping with our vision and ethos, KEM Hospital Pune is committed to providing state-of-the-art healthcare for patients across all socio-economic strata.
